Texas Hold'em — The World's Most Popular Poker Game

When people talk about poker, they are almost certainly referring to Texas Hold'em. It is the format you see at the World Series of Poker (WSOP), in Hollywood films, and on TV — and it is the most popular format at mahkota69 tables too. Each player receives two private cards (hole cards) and must combine them with five community cards to form the best five-card hand.

The beauty of Texas Hold'em lies in its balance between luck and skill. A single hand may be decided by the cards that fall, but over hundreds or thousands of hands, the smarter, more disciplined player who understands probability will consistently come out ahead. Pot-Limit Omaha — The Choice of Experienced Players

Players who have mastered Texas Hold'em often make the switch to Pot-Limit Omaha (PLO) for a greater challenge. In PLO, each player receives four hole cards (compared to two in Hold'em) and must use exactly two of them alongside three of the five community cards. This creates far more hand combinations, larger average pots, and significantly more intense action.

10 Core Poker Principles for Malaysian Players

These principles have been proven across millions of poker hands worldwide. Follow this guide and you'll become a stronger player at the mahkota69 tables.

01
Only Play Strong Starting Hands

New players often play too many hands. The discipline to fold weak hands is the number one skill in poker.

02
Know Your Position at the Table

Acting after other players (late position) gives you more information — use that advantage to the fullest.

03
Don't Limp Too Often

Entering the pot by just calling the blind (limping) without raising typically weakens your position. Raise or fold — it is the better play in most situations.

04
Betting for Value (Value Bet)

When you have a strong hand, bet a size that makes it expensive for weaker hands to stay in the pot.

05
Bluff Carefully and with a Clear Plan

A good bluff tells a consistent story. Never bluff randomly — experienced opponents will see right through it.

06
Manage Your Bankroll with Strict Discipline

Never play stakes that exceed 5% of your total bankroll. This protects you from the inevitable downswings.

07
Read Your Opponents' Actions, Not Just Your Own Cards

Pay attention to your opponents' betting patterns. How do they bet in different situations? That information is worth more than the cards in your own hand.

08
Avoid Playing on Tilt

Suffering a big loss and betting even bigger to get even is called "tilt" — every poker player's worst enemy. Step away whenever you feel your emotions getting the better of you.

09
Review Your Game After Each Session

Review your key hands after each session. Where did you make the wrong call? Where did you leave value on the table? Continuous learning is what separates everyday players from the pros.

10
Take Notes on Your Opponents

Poker Terms You Need to Know

Learn the language of poker before sitting down at a mahkota69 table — these are terms you will hear every single day in the poker room.

Glossary Meaning
BLINDMandatory bets posted before cards are dealt — the Small Blind and Big Blind rotate each hand.
PREFLOPThe betting round after players receive their two hole cards, before the first community card is dealt.
FLOPThe first three community cards dealt face-up simultaneously in the centre of the table.
TURNThe fourth community card dealt after the Flop betting round.
RIVERThe fifth and final community card — the last betting round before the showdown.
CHECKPass your turn without betting — only allowed when there is no active bet in the current round.
RAISERaising during a hand — forcing other players to match, re-raise, or fold.
ALL-INPutting all your chips on the line in a single hand — maximum pressure on your opponent.
POT ODDSThe ratio of the pot size to the cost of calling — used to mathematically determine whether a call is worth making.
C-BETContinuation bet — betting on the Flop after you were the one who bet or raised pre-flop, regardless of whether the Flop improved your hand.
SHOWDOWNThe final phase where remaining players reveal their cards to determine who wins the pot.
TILTA negative emotional state following a loss that causes a player to make irrational decisions — avoid this at all costs.
